Biotechnology has revolutionized the manufacturing industry, and its impact is only expected to grow in the coming years. Biotech manufacturing services involve the use of living organisms, cells, and biomolecules to create products and processes that improve people's lives. From food and medicine production to sustainable energy solutions, biotech manufacturing has numerous positive benefits that are shaping the future of manufacturing.

Here are some of the key positive impacts of biotech manufacturing services:

1. Improved Product Quality

Biotech manufacturing services utilize the latest techniques and technologies to produce high-quality products. With the use of advanced genetic engineering techniques, biotech companies can create organisms with specific traits that make them more efficient in producing desired products. This results in products with superior quality, consistency, and purity, making them safer and more effective for consumers.

2. Increased Production Efficiency

Compared to traditional manufacturing methods, biotech manufacturing is more efficient and cost-effective. The use of genetically modified organisms allows for faster and more precise production of desired products, ultimately reducing the overall production time and cost. Further, biotech manufacturing also minimizes waste and energy consumption, making it a more environmentally friendly option.

3. Diversification of Products

Biotech manufacturing services have largely contributed to the diversification of products in the market. With the use of genetically engineered organisms, biotech companies can produce a wide variety of products with improved characteristics, such as increased nutrition, better taste, and longer shelf life. This has opened up new opportunities in different industries, from cosmetics and household products to pharmaceuticals and agriculture.

4. Advancements in Medicine

Biotech manufacturing has brought significant advancements in the medical field. With the use of biotechnology, scientists can manufacture medicines, vaccines, and other medical products that were previously impossible or highly expensive to produce. For example, biotech manufacturing has played a crucial role in the rapid production of COVID-19 vaccines, proving its importance in times of global health crises.

5. Sustainable Solutions

Biotech manufacturing services have made significant contributions to sustainable development. The use of biodegradable materials and sustainable production processes has reduced the environmental impact of manufacturing. Biotech companies are also working towards developing sustainable energy sources, such as biofuels made from renewable sources like algae. This not only reduces our dependence on fossil fuels but also helps in mitigating climate change.

6. Economic Growth and Job Creation

The growth of biotech manufacturing has also led to an increase in job opportunities and economic growth. As biotech companies continue to expand, they bring in new jobs in research, development, manufacturing, and other related fields. According to a report by the Biotechnology Innovation Organization (BIO), the biotech industry supports over 1.74 million jobs in the United States alone. Moreover, as more companies invest in biotech manufacturing, it contributes to economic growth and can potentially boost local economies.
